A post-pollination prefertilization drop can be seen exuding from the micropylar opening of a Douglas-fir (Pseudotsuga menziesii) ovule following removal of an ovuliferous scale-bract complex from a female cone. Scale bar = 1 mm. Photo credit: Coulter et al., 2026

Dispatched 1,500 saplings from our Dabla Talab nursery to develop the 9th Chaudhary Charan Singh Smriti Van at NRCC, Bikaner.

🌿 Included rare Ephedra foliata — Rajasthan’s only #gymnosperm, now near extinction. We’ve created the world’s first Ephedra nursery to revive this vital desert species.

Ginkgo tree (Ginkgo Biloba), also known as maidenhair tree. A species of gymnosperm tree considered a living fossil, as it hasn’t changed for almost 200 million years. #ginkgobiloba #tree #gymnosperm

🌎🍄🌾🌱🍅🌳🧪 Ginkgo or gingko or maidenhair tree. Ginkgo biloba, last species left alive of the #gymnosperm plant order Ginkgoales that originated over 270 million years ago. Once grew across the northern hemisphere, now only a small area in China, and where planted by humans.
